[0029] Example 1 Synthesis of nitroaromatic compounds

[0030] Preparation of 4-iodo-3-nitrobenzamide

[0031]1025mg of 4-iodo-3-nitrobenzoic acid (provided by Chemica Alta Ltd., Edmonton, Alberta, Canada) was dissolved in 10ml of N,N-dimethylformamide, cooled to 10°C, then 0.76ml of chlorinated Sulfoxide, stirred at room temperature for 1 hour, then added to 20ml of pre-cooled concentrated ammonia water to obtain a black-yellow mixture, stirred for 5 minutes, added 50ml of pre-cooled deionized water, a bright yellow precipitate appeared, and cooled in an ice bath for 10 minutes , the precipitate was filtered off with suction, rinsed with cold water and then dried in vacuo to obtain 500.4 mg of crude product, which was recrystallized from acetonitrile to obtain 415.2 mg of 4-iodo-3-nitrobenzamide, melting point: 152-155°C. Abstract

The invention relates to a novel application of aromatic nitro compound in the pharmaceutical field, in particular to the application of aromatic nitro compound in treating viral hepatitis. The aromatic nitro compound can be used alone or can be combined with other commonly used anti- viral hepatitis drugs to effectively restrain the replication and secretion of hepatitis virus. The aromatic nitro compound can remarkably restrain the replication and secretion of hepatitis virus in the bodies of mammals. The aromatic nitro compound is especially suitable for treating the diseases caused by hepatitis B virus and hepatitis C. The invention provides the concrete method for treating the patients with hepatitis B and hepatitis C.

technical field [0001] The present invention relates to the field of treatment of viral hepatitis, more particularly, the present invention relates to the application of 3-nitro-4-iodo-benzamide and its derivatives alone or in combination with other antiviral compounds in the treatment of viral hepatitis. Background technique [0002] Viral hepatitis (viral heptitis) is a common infectious disease caused by a variety of hepatitis viruses. The main clinical manifestations are fatigue, loss of appetite, nausea, vomiting, hepatomegaly and liver function damage. Some patients may have jaundice and fever. Some patients experience hives, arthralgia, or upper respiratory symptoms. There are five types of viral hepatitis: A, B, C, D and E.
